AutoGPT:全自动AI助手如何重塑开发范式
2025.09.26 16:15浏览量:8简介:本文深入解析AutoGPT作为全自动人工智能助手的核心技术、应用场景及开发实践,揭示其如何通过自主任务分解与执行机制提升开发效率,并探讨企业级部署的挑战与解决方案。
AutoGPT:全自动AI助手如何重塑开发范式
一、AutoGPT的技术内核:从被动响应到主动决策的跨越
AutoGPT的核心突破在于其自主任务分解与执行框架。传统AI助手(如ChatGPT)依赖用户明确输入指令,而AutoGPT通过引入元认知层,实现了从问题理解到任务拆解的全自动化流程。例如,当用户提出”优化电商平台的用户留存率”时,AutoGPT会自主完成以下步骤:
- 需求解析:通过语义分析识别关键指标(用户留存率)与业务场景(电商平台)
- 任务拆解:生成子任务树(如A/B测试方案、用户画像分析、推送策略优化)
- 工具链调用:自动调用数据分析API、用户行为追踪系统等外部工具
- 结果验证:建立多维度评估体系(转化率提升、用户满意度)
这种架构的底层支撑是强化学习驱动的决策引擎。AutoGPT采用PPO(Proximal Policy Optimization)算法,在模拟环境中通过数百万次交互训练出最优任务执行路径。其神经网络结构包含:
- 输入层:处理多模态输入(文本、结构化数据、API响应)
- 注意力机制:动态聚焦关键任务节点
- 输出层:生成可执行的代码片段或API调用指令
二、开发场景的革命性应用
1. 自动化代码生成与调试
在软件开发领域,AutoGPT展现了端到端代码生成能力。以开发一个RESTful API为例:
# AutoGPT生成的Flask API示例from flask import Flask, jsonify, requestapp = Flask(__name__)@app.route('/api/users', methods=['GET'])def get_users():# 自主连接数据库并处理分页page = request.args.get('page', 1, type=int)per_page = 10offset = (page - 1) * per_pageusers = User.query.offset(offset).limit(per_page).all() # 假设已定义User模型return jsonify([{'id': u.id, 'name': u.name} for u in users])if __name__ == '__main__':app.run(debug=True)
AutoGPT不仅能生成基础代码,还能:
- 自动添加异常处理机制
- 生成配套的单元测试
- 优化数据库查询效率
- 部署到指定云平台
2. 企业级数据治理
某金融企业部署AutoGPT后,实现了数据管道的自主管理:
- 自动识别数据源(SQL数据库、API接口、日志文件)
- 构建数据清洗规则(去重、缺失值填充、类型转换)
- 生成可视化报表并推送至业务部门
- 持续监控数据质量指标
该方案使数据工程师的工作量减少70%,同时将数据可用性从68%提升至92%。
三、企业部署的实践指南
1. 架构设计要点
企业级AutoGPT部署需构建三层架构:
- 控制层:任务分配与资源调度
- 执行层:AutoGPT实例集群
- 数据层:知识库与工具链集成
典型配置参数:
| 组件 | 推荐规格 |
|——————-|———————————————|
| 计算节点 | 8vCPU/32GB内存/NVIDIA A100 |
| 存储 | 分布式文件系统(如Ceph) |
| 网络 | 10Gbps内网带宽 |
2. 安全防护体系
需建立五道防线:
- 输入过滤:防止恶意指令注入
- 权限隔离:按部门划分数据访问权限
- 审计日志:记录所有AI操作轨迹
- 异常检测:实时监控非预期行为
- 应急终止:手动中断危险任务
3. 性能优化策略
通过以下方法提升AutoGPT效率:
- 任务缓存:存储常见任务的解决方案
- 并行执行:将独立子任务分配至不同实例
- 增量学习:持续吸收领域知识
- 硬件加速:使用TensorRT优化推理速度
四、开发者能力进阶路径
1. 提示工程2.0
传统提示词设计已演变为任务蓝图构建。有效模板示例:
[目标] 开发一个用户行为分析系统[约束] 使用Python/Pandas,处理10GB以上数据[子任务]1. 数据加载(指定CSV路径)2. 特征工程(定义5个关键指标)3. 异常检测(设置3σ阈值)4. 可视化输出(生成交互式仪表盘)
2. 调试与优化技巧
当AutoGPT输出不符合预期时,可采取:
- 分步验证:检查每个子任务的输出
- 上下文注入:补充缺失的业务规则
- 反馈循环:标记错误结果供模型学习
- 参数调整:修改温度系数或最大生成长度
五、未来展望:从工具到协作伙伴
AutoGPT的发展正朝向认知共生方向演进:
- 情境感知:理解开发者的情绪状态和工作节奏
- 主动建议:在代码编写前预测潜在问题
- 跨团队协作:协调多个AutoGPT实例完成大型项目
- 伦理约束:内置道德准则防止有害应用
某汽车制造商的实践显示,引入AutoGPT后:
- 需求分析周期从2周缩短至3天
- 代码缺陷率下降45%
- 跨部门协作效率提升60%
结语:拥抱全自动AI时代
AutoGPT代表的不仅是技术突破,更是开发范式的根本性变革。对于开发者而言,掌握与AI协作的能力将成为核心竞争力;对于企业来说,构建智能化的开发基础设施是赢得未来的关键。建议从以下方面着手:
- 建立AutoGPT能力评估体系
- 开发领域特定的知识插件
- 培养人机协作的团队文化
- 持续跟踪模型进化动态
在这个全自动AI助手驱动的新时代,唯有主动拥抱变革者,方能在技术浪潮中立于潮头。

发表评论
登录后可评论,请前往 登录 或 注册